Run VCall Finder
Run ida_analyze_bin.py with an explicit module list and symbol list. Never add vcall_finder entries to an analysis
config, use *, or infer additional modules or symbols.
Resolve Inputs
- Require one or more exact module names and one or more exact symbol names from the user. Ask for missing or ambiguous values before running the workflow.
- Use the exact
GAMEVERfrom the request. If omitted, readCS2VIBE_GAMEVERfrom.env; ask if it is absent or empty. Do not substitute another version. - Use the requested platform list. If omitted, allow the analyzer default of
windows,linux. - Require
configs/<GAMEVER>.yamland the selected binaries underbin/<GAMEVER>. Do not modify the config or download missing binaries as part of this skill.
Run The Analysis
Run from the repository root. Join multiple modules and symbols with commas:
uv run ida_analyze_bin.py -gamever <GAMEVER> -configyaml configs/<GAMEVER>.yaml -modules <MODULES> -vcall_finder <SYMBOLS> -debug
Add -platform <PLATFORMS> only when the user specifies platforms. Forward user-requested -llm_model,
-llm_baseurl, -llm_temperature, -llm_effort, or -llm_fake_as values. Prefer CS2VIBE_LLM_* environment
variables for credentials and never print or persist API keys.
Do not add -skip_error unless the user explicitly requests best-effort processing. Do not silently retry with other
modules, symbols, platforms, game versions, or cached detail files.
The analyzer applies every requested symbol to every requested module. Split the work into separate invocations when different symbols require different module scopes.
Report Results
Treat exit code 0 with Failed: 0 in the final summary as success. Report:
- the exact game version, modules, symbols, and platforms;
- the per-function detail root at
vcall_finder/<GAMEVER>/<SYMBOL>/; - the aggregated output at
vcall_finder/<GAMEVER>/<SYMBOL>.txtwhen produced.
